# Service Accounts — Quillback GraphQL Layer

Quick note for reviewers of the N+1 fix in the Quillback resolver stack: we swapped the per-node author lookups for a batched dataloader, which means the resolver now talks to the internal Hollyvane profile service directly instead of going through the gateway.

That requires its own service account — don't reuse the gateway one, it lacks batch-read scope. The account is `svc-quillback-batch`, read-only, rotated quarterly.

For local testing against staging, authenticate with the key below.

API key for yahig-tadup: kto7_ubizbYm

**Cold starts on Bramblehook handlers.** If you're seeing 8–10 second latencies after quiet periods, that's the runtime spinning up fresh containers. Quick fix: bump the `warmPoolSize` in the Bramblehook console to 3 and the pre-warmer will keep instances hot. If latency persists, the pre-warmer itself may be failing auth against the scheduler API — check its logs for 401s. To re-authenticate the pre-warmer manually, call the scheduler endpoint using the bearer token below.

bearer token for bajef-yagap: eyJhbGciOiJIUzI1NiIsInR5cCI6IkpXVCJ9.eyJzdWIiOiISx5vUAfqCBIn0.VoNF_nOW3W-u

Minutes — Management Meeting, Joint Venture Proposal

Prepared for the incoming director. Attendees reviewed Halbrook Systems' proposal for a joint venture covering the Meravale distribution corridor. Discussion covered equity split, governance, and exit clauses; counsel flagged the non-compete term as overly broad. A revised draft is expected within two weeks. The board asked that the underlying commercial intent be recorded in the confidential note that follows.

management briefing: Project Ulavan slips by two quarters because of the staffing delay.

### Action Item: Spoolhaven Retry Storm

From last Tuesday's outage: the Spoolhaven print service retried failed jobs without backoff, saturating the render pool. Fix merged; retries now use capped exponential backoff with jitter. Owner will monitor for a week before closing. The agreed retry constants are recorded below.

constants for yadup-kajof:
RATE_LIMITS = {
    "zorwyn": 1,
    "druwyn": 1,
}